The property is a 17th-century home with Georgian and Edwardian windows, standing among period properties in Crowthers Hill, Dartmouth. The kitchen has natural light, authentic features, and Georgian windows offering views of Dartmouth's rooftops and the Royal Naval College. There is a dining space, utility area, and cloakroom. The lounge has high ceilings, wooden floors, and dual-aspect windows framing the view across the town. A Georgian staircase leads to the upper floor, where the principal bedroom has dual-aspect windows capturing views and a built-in en-suite. Two further double bedrooms share a Jack and Jill shower room. The lower ground floor features a self-contained space with a kitchen, dining, living area, and double bedroom with en-suite, accessed through a private entrance. A decked seating area is located at the front of the property.
